Knitted tops are a versatile addition to any wardrobe. They can be styled in various ways, making them perfect for different occasions. Try layering a chunky knitted top over a crisp button-up shirt. This adds texture and visual interest to your outfit. Pair it with tailored trousers for a polished look. You’ll feel comfortable yet chic.
For a more relaxed vibe, consider wearing a fitted knitted top with high-waisted jeans. This combination creates a flattering silhouette. Don’t forget to accessorize with statement jewelry or a bright scarf. It can elevate the entire look. Sometimes, even experimental pairings can work. A flowy skirt with a loose knitted top can create an effortless style.
